////////////////////////////////////////////////////////////////////////////// // // (C) Copyright Ion Gaztanaga 2009-2012. Distributed under the Boost // Software License, Version 1.0. (See accompanying file // LICENSE_1_0.txt or copy at http://www.boost.org/LICENSE_1_0.txt) // // See http://www.boost.org/libs/interprocess for documentation. // ////////////////////////////////////////////////////////////////////////////// #ifndef BOOST_INTERPROCESS_BASIC_GLOBAL_MEMORY_HPP #define BOOST_INTERPROCESS_BASIC_GLOBAL_MEMORY_HPP #ifndef BOOST_CONFIG_HPP # include <boost/config.hpp> #endif # #if defined(BOOST_HAS_PRAGMA_ONCE) #pragma once #endif #include <boost/interprocess/detail/config_begin.hpp> #include <boost/interprocess/detail/workaround.hpp> #include <boost/interprocess/offset_ptr.hpp> #include <boost/interprocess/sync/spin/mutex.hpp> #include <boost/interprocess/sync/spin/recursive_mutex.hpp> #include <boost/interprocess/detail/managed_memory_impl.hpp> #include <boost/interprocess/detail/managed_open_or_create_impl.hpp> #include <boost/interprocess/mem_algo/rbtree_best_fit.hpp> #include <boost/interprocess/indexes/iset_index.hpp> #include <boost/interprocess/creation_tags.hpp> #include <boost/interprocess/permissions.hpp> namespace boost{ namespace interprocess{ namespace ipcdetail{ struct intermodule_singleton_mutex_family { typedef boost::interprocess::ipcdetail::spin_mutex mutex_type; typedef boost::interprocess::ipcdetail::spin_recursive_mutex recursive_mutex_type; }; struct intermodule_types { //We must use offset_ptr since a loaded DLL can map the singleton holder shared memory //at a different address than other DLLs or the main executable typedef rbtree_best_fit<intermodule_singleton_mutex_family, offset_ptr<void> > mem_algo; template<class Device, bool FileBased> struct open_or_create { typedef managed_open_or_create_impl <Device, mem_algo::Alignment, FileBased, false> type; }; }; //we must implement our own managed shared memory to avoid circular dependencies template<class Device, bool FileBased> class basic_managed_global_memory : public basic_managed_memory_impl < char , intermodule_types::mem_algo , iset_index , intermodule_types::open_or_create<Device, FileBased>::type::ManagedOpenOrCreateUserOffset > , private intermodule_types::open_or_create<Device, FileBased>::type { #if !defined(BOOST_INTERPROCESS_DOXYGEN_INVOKED) typedef typename intermodule_types::template open_or_create<Device, FileBased>::type base2_t; typedef basic_managed_memory_impl < char , intermodule_types::mem_algo , iset_index , base2_t::ManagedOpenOrCreateUserOffset > base_t; typedef create_open_func<base_t> create_open_func_t; basic_managed_global_memory *get_this_pointer() { return this; } public: typedef typename base_t::size_type size_type; private: typedef typename base_t::char_ptr_holder_t char_ptr_holder_t; BOOST_MOVABLE_BUT_NOT_COPYABLE(basic_managed_global_memory) #endif //#ifndef BOOST_INTERPROCESS_DOXYGEN_INVOKED public: //functions basic_managed_global_memory (open_or_create_t open_or_create, const char *name, size_type size, const void *addr = 0, const permissions& perm = permissions()) : base_t() , base2_t(open_or_create, name, size, read_write, addr, create_open_func_t(get_this_pointer(), DoOpenOrCreate), perm) {} basic_managed_global_memory (open_only_t open_only, const char* name, const void *addr = 0) : base_t() , base2_t(open_only, name, read_write, addr, create_open_func_t(get_this_pointer(), DoOpen)) {} }; } //namespace ipcdetail{ } //namespace interprocess{ } //namespace boost{ #include <boost/interprocess/detail/config_end.hpp> #endif //#ifndef BOOST_INTERPROCESS_BASIC_GLOBAL_MEMORY_HPP
